Your profile

Update your photo, personal details and contact information, and request a change to the fields your school controls.

Profile holds your personal and contact details. Some of it you can edit yourself, and some of it your school owns. The form makes the difference visible rather than leaving you guessing.

What is on the page

Your photo sits at the top, uploadable from your device. Below it the fields are split into two sections.

SectionFields
PersonalFirst name, Last name, Gender, Date of birth, Place of birth, ID number
Contact and addressPhone, Country, Region, City, Address

Country, Region and City work as a chain: choosing a country loads its regions, and choosing a region loads its cities. Changing the country higher up clears what was chosen below it, because those choices no longer make sense.

Editing

Change what you need and select Save changes. A bar appears while you have unsaved work, and it tells you if something needs fixing before the save can go through. Cancel discards your edits.

You are warned before losing unsaved edits

Navigating away or closing the tab with unsaved changes prompts you to confirm first, so a half-finished edit is not lost by accident.

Fields your school controls

Which fields you may edit is set by your school, so two students at different schools can see different things locked. A locked field is marked as managed by your school and shows its current value read-only. Where nothing has been recorded it reads Not set.

Select Request change

Every locked field has this option next to it.

Enter the value you want

Type the correct value, then select Send request.

Wait for review

The field is marked Pending review and your request goes to staff. You can withdraw it with Cancel request at any point before they act on it.

Once staff apply the change, the field shows the new value and the pending mark disappears.

Your email address is not editable here

Email is shown but is not one of the fields you can edit or request a change to. Because it is how you sign in, changing it has to be done by your school.

What is not on this page

  • No password field. To change your password, use Forgot Password on the sign-in page. See Activating your account.
  • No Settings page. The language switch is in your account menu, next to Profile. There is no notification preference screen in this version.
